Ranger Boats was established by Forrest L. Wood, who made it a national company before it was sold in 1987. Many anglers considered it the first ever design of a bassboat. The ranger was quickly a success, selling 1,200 units in just two years. Unfortunately, the factory that owned the company was set on fire in 1971. Wood crawled through a window to discover a notebook that contained 60 boat orders.

Consider the insulation of your cooler. A high-quality cooler is worth the investment if you intend to keep cold drinks and food cool during long journeys. There are many sizes of Yeti coolers, with the Tundra 110 the most expensive model. The RTIC Ice Chest is also available in 65-, 110 and 145-quart sizes. Although it is possible to purchase an inexpensive ice chest from Amazon, you will be glad you bought a high-quality one.
